Extinction Rebellion stage North Sea oil and gas extraction protests across six countries

Extinction Rebellion stage North Sea oil and gas extraction protests across six countries

Daily Record

Published

Extinction Rebellion (XR) Scotland staged action at various locations on Saturday including Aberdeen, Shetland and Dundee as part of worldwide demonstrations.

Full Article